Abstract
The utility model belongs to engine apparatus technical field, it is related to a kind of air-cooled single-cylinder diesel engine cabinet, including cabinet main body, crankshaft cavity is arranged in the cabinet lower body part, bearing is set in crankshaft cavity body, cylinder sleeve is arranged in cabinet body top, cooling fin is set corresponding to the outside of cylinder sleeve in cabinet main body, correspond to the totally-enclosed support construction in one end setting left side of cooling fin along its length in cabinet main body, the upper end of the totally-enclosed support construction in left side and the left end of cooling fin are tightly connected, correspond to the totally-enclosed support construction in other end setting right side of cooling fin along its length in cabinet main body.The utility model product supports cylinder sleeve of engine using totally enclosed type support construction, avoids cylinder-liner distortion in diesel engine operation process;Two sides totally enclosed type support construction and engine housing integral type can effectively improve the rigidity of diesel engine box body;Two sides totally enclosed type support construction forms bigger cooling fin, the cooling performance of diesel engine can be effectively improved, to improve the diesel engine service life.

The utility model product cabinet by cabinet main body 1, cylinder sleeve 2 and 3 die casting of bearing together, wherein cabinet main body 1
The totally-enclosed support construction in a left side 4 and right totally-enclosed support construction 5 and cooling fin 6 can improve the rigidity of cabinet entirety well,
Cylinder sleeve 2 can be effectively supported simultaneously, its deformation due to caused by the variation of ignition temperature in diesel engine operation process is prevented, has
The deterioration of engine emission, can effectively be promoted caused by effect avoids lubricating oil caused by deforming because of cylinder sleeve 2 from scurrying into combustion chamber
The environmental-protecting performance of diesel engine, while avoiding lubricating oil from scurrying into caused engine combustion in combustion chamber and deteriorating, improve engine
Reliability and durability.
It, can pole after the totally-enclosed support construction 4 in a left side for the cabinet main body 1 and right totally-enclosed support construction 5 are made totally enclosed type
The area of big raising cooling fin 6 mentions to preferably cool down to cylinder sleeve 2 in engine operation process and cabinet main body
The service life of high diesel engine.
The utility model product can effectively improve the rigidity and cooling performance of diesel engine, improve the diesel engine service life.
